Singapore’s Thomson Medical goes live with electronic medical record
Thomson Medical, a provider of healthcare for women and children in Singapore, has gone live with MEDITECH’s electronic medical record Expanse at the maternity-focused Thomson Medical Centre. US’s Aptar Digital Health acquires Singapore-based Healint
In the US, Aptar Digital Health, a provider of digital health solutions, has announced its acquisition of Healint, a Singapore-based company specialising in multimodal health and the generation of real-world evidence for improving treatment outcomes and expediting clinical trials. Singapore-based Qritive announces collaboration with diagnostic centres and hospitals in India
Singapore-based AI solution provider Qritive has announced an upcoming collaboration with three diagnostic centres and hospitals in India: Metropolis Healthcare, the Rajiv Gandhi Cancer Institute and CŌRE Diagnostics. Digital healthcare hub established in Singapore
German science and technology company Merck has established its first digital hub in Singapore with the aim of supporting advancements within healthcare. Philips Future Health Index 2023 places Singapore’s health sector “at the forefront of digital tech”
Philips’ Future Health Index 2023 has placed Singapore’s health sector “at the forefront of digital technology” on workforce, efficiency and sustainability.
